Haojiaying Township

Haojiaying Township, belonging to Zhangbei County, Zhangjiakou City, Hebei Province, is located in the northeast of Zhangbei County, adjacent to baimiaotan Township in the East, xiaoertai Township and Zhangbei town in the south, mantouying Township in the west, ertai Township and erquanjing Township in the north. It is 15 kilometers away from the people's government of Zhangbei County, with a total area of 163.3 square kilometers.

In 1946, haojiaying township was located in the first district of Zhangbei County (damiaoying District); in 1984, it was changed from dukounao commune to haojiaying township. By the end of 2018, the registered residence population of hajiaying township was 14773. As of June 2020, haojiaying township has 17 administrative villages under its jurisdiction, and the Township People's government is located at No. 002, government street.

The main food crops in haojiaying township are naked oats and potatoes, and the main animal husbandry is raising cows and sheep. In 2018, haojiaying Township had 38 comprehensive stores or supermarkets with a business area of more than 50 square meters.

History of construction

In 1946, it was a district of Zhangbei County (damiaoying District). In 1947, it was divided into seven districts (yangjiaying District).

In 1949, it belonged to nine districts.

On June 1, 1956, the township of tongkounao (chenglongweizi) was established.

In 1961, the township was changed into the commune.

On December 4, 1968, it was renamed Dongfeng commune.

In January 1972, it was renamed the counterpart Nao commune.

In 1984, the commune was changed into haojiaying township.

administrative division

In 1997, haojiaying Township had 17 administrative villages under its jurisdiction: panchengying, naobaowa, xigaomiao, xindifang, wufutang, damiaoying, yudaiwan, yangjiaying, siweizi, shanfangzi, wanshuntang, Mudanhua, sanyimei, Weizi, chahanhulun, chalaobuqi and dukounao.

By the end of 2011, haojiaying Township had 17 administrative villages including tongkounao, xindifang, xigaomiao, chalaobuqi, damiaoying, Mudanhua, siweizi, shanfangzi, naobaowa, wufutang, sanyimei, chahanhulun, wanshuntang, yudaiwan, panchengying, yangjiaying and Weizi, and 59 natural villages.

As of June 2020, haojiaying township has 17 administrative villages: damiaoying village, Weizi village, tongkounao village, shanfangzi village, Mudanhua village, panchengying village, wanshuntang village, yangjiaying village, chalaowuqi village, naobaowa village, sanyimei village, xindifang village, chahanhulun village, xigaomiao village, wufutang village, yudaiwan village and siweizi village. The Township People's government is stationed at No. 002, government street.

geographical environment

Location context

Haojiaying township is located in the northeast of Zhangbei County, adjacent to baimiaotan Township in the East, xiaoertai Township and Zhangbei town in the south, mantouying Township in the west, ertai Township and erquanjing Township in the north. It is 15 kilometers away from the people's Government of Zhangbei County, with a total area of 163.3 square kilometers.

topographic features

Haojiaying Township belongs to the central plain of Zhangbei County, with an altitude of 1500 meters.

climate

The main climatic characteristics of haojiaying township are low temperature, frost free period of 90-110 days, drought and windy, long sunshine time, annual average temperature of 2.6 ℃ and annual rainfall of 350-550 mm.

hydrology

In haojiaying Township, there are counterpart lakes, with a total area of 1.33 square kilometers, belonging to seasonal rivers.

soil

The sandy land in haojiaying Township accounts for more than 80%.

natural resources

In 2011, haojiaying township has cultivated land area of 61800 mu, 4.2 mu per capita; available grassland area of 50000 mu, forest land area of 39300 mu.

population

At the end of 2011, the total population of haojiaying township was 14754, of which 305 were urban permanent residents, accounting for 2.1% of the urbanization rate; among the total population, 7509 were male, accounting for 50.9%; 7245 were female, accounting for 49.1%; 3261 were under 18 years old, accounting for 22.1%; 2983 were between 19 and 35 years old, accounting for 20.2%; 6523 were between 36 and 60 years old, accounting for 44.2%; 1987 were over 61 years old, accounting for 13.5%; 14698 were mainly Han nationality, accounting for 99.6%; there were Manchu and Mongolian Ancient, Miao, Yi, Zhuang, Hui ethnic minorities, a total of 56 people, accounting for 0.4%. In 2011, the birth rate of haojiaying township was 8.3 ‰, the mortality rate was 6.7 ‰, the natural growth rate of population was 1.6 ‰, and the population density was 92 people per square kilometer.

At the end of 2017, the permanent resident population of haojiaying township was 8578.

By the end of 2018, the registered residence population of hajiaying township was 14773.

Economics

overview

In 2011, the total revenue of haojiaying township was 3.1766 million yuan, an increase of 5.6% over 2010. In 2011, the per capita net income of farmers in haojiaying township was 3687 yuan.

Agriculture

The main food crops in haojiaying township are naked oats and potatoes. In 2011, haojiaying Township produced 8393.5 tons of grain, including 7620 tons of potatoes, 654 tons of naked oats, 6 tons of wheat, 99 tons of kidney beans, 4.7 tons of soybeans, 5 tons of broad beans and 4.8 tons of peas. The main economic crops in haojiaying township are oil crops, sugar beets, vegetables, etc. In 2011, the sugar beet planting area in haojiaying township was 14200 mu, with an output of 35500 tons; the oil crops planting area was 4000 mu, with an output of 267 tons, including 29 tons of rape seeds and 238 tons of flax seeds. Animal husbandry in haojiaying township is mainly for raising cows and sheep. In 2011, there were 12892 sheep on hand at the end of the year in haojiaying township; the number of cows was 35000 and the fresh milk output was 9563 tons; the total output value of animal husbandry was 82.61 million yuan, accounting for 57.3% of the total agricultural output value.

Commerce and trade

At the end of 2011, there were 65 commercial outlets and 130 employees in haojiaying township.

In 2018, haojiaying Township had 38 comprehensive stores or supermarkets with a business area of more than 50 square meters.

social undertakings

education

At the end of 2011, there was one kindergarten in haojiaying Township with 60 children and 4 full-time teachers; one primary school with 294 students and 41 full-time teachers. The enrollment rate of school-age children in primary school, enrollment rate of middle school age population, enrollment rate of primary school to primary school and nine-year compulsory education coverage reached 100%. In 2011, the education fund of haojiaying Township reached 0.004 billion yuan, and the national financial education fund was 0.004 billion yuan.

Cultural and sports undertakings

At the end of 2011, the comprehensive radio coverage rate of haojiaying township was 100%.

medical and health work

At the end of 2011, there was a health center in haojiaying Township, with 20 beds and a total fixed asset value of 650000 yuan; there were 8 professional health personnel, including 2 licensed doctors, 2 licensed assistant doctors and 1 registered nurse. In 2011, haojiaying Township Health Center completed 9000 person times of diagnosis and treatment, and 13398 people participated in the new rural cooperative medical system, with a participation rate of 97%.

social security

In 2011, the number of rural minimum living security households in haojiaying township was 1331, with 1740 people, and the expenditure was 1.349 million yuan, an increase of 31.5% compared with 2010, and the monthly per capita was 65 yuan; 90 people were provided by the five guarantees in rural areas, and the expenditure was 252000 yuan, an increase of 57% compared with 2010; 46 people were provided by the five guarantees in rural areas, and the expenditure was 75600 yuan, an increase of 5% compared with 2010; 193 people were provided with medical assistance in rural areas, and the total expenditure was 342000 yuan 1808 people were subsidized to participate in the cooperative medical system, with an expenditure of 90400 yuan, an increase of 39.9% over 2010; 90 people were given temporary assistance in rural areas, with an expenditure of 27000 yuan, an increase of 20% in 2010; 22 people were given state pension and subsidies, with 92 people enjoying the living allowance for retired soldiers aged 60; 9852 people participated in social endowment insurance, with 2199 people receiving social endowment insurance; there was one central nursing home with beds Count 123.

Post and telecommunication

In 2011, the rural postal rate of haojiaying was 100%.

traffic

In haojiaying Township, there is Zhangshi expressway, which is 5 kilometers long; National Highway 207, which is 10 kilometers long, leads to Guyuan and Inner Mongolia; there is a county-level highway, which is 22.5 kilometers long.

History and culture

Haojiaying township is named after the Township People's government's residence in haojiaying village.

famous scenery

Haojiaying township has Zhongdu primitive grassland resort.
